Study of the radiation of a radial waveguide - Applications to pretuned modules and to circular disk antennas
Abstract
The design of solid state millimeter wave oscillators or functions can be achieved with the use of pretuned-modules. The theoretical models previously developed are no longer valid if the thickness of such a module becomes important, as it will for silicon monolithic modules. A new resolution method for the radiation of a abruptly-ended radial waveguide is proposed. The first results are presented and the extension of the method to the problems of circular disk antennas or microstrip patch antennas is discussed.
